One cup of Chinese sweet is around 237 grams and contains approximately 946 calories, 12 grams of protein, 35 grams of fat, and 166 grams of carbohydrates.

Chinese Sweet is a delightful blend of flavors that showcases the rich culinary heritage of China. Made from ingredients like sticky rice, mung beans, and natural sweeteners such as rock sugar or honey, these treats can range from chewy rice cakes to smooth, velvety puddings. Often enjoyed during festivals and celebrations, Chinese Sweets come in vibrant colors, each symbolizing good fortune and happiness. While they offer comfort and indulgence, many varieties are made with wholesome ingredients, providing natural energy. However, moderation is key, as some can be high in sugar.
